This weekly series of show-and-tell-style events features open, skill-share lessons – led by Philadelphia-based artists, curators, writers, filmmakers and other cultural producers - on a wide range of topics.
This week's featured guests and sharings are:
Kaytie Johnson | Plush: A Brief History of Black Velvet Paintings
Kate Kraczon | Trial and Error: Non-Expert Advice for the Collection, Alteration and Care of 1890s-1940s Clothing
Ben Will & Sarah Eberle | Everything you Need to Know to Sabotage Your Art Career
About the participants: Kaytie Johnson, Rochelle F. Levy Director and Chief Curator, The Galleries at Moore; Kate Kraczon, assistant curator, ICA Philadelphia; Ben Will, artist and co-director of RebekahTempleton Gallery; Sarah Eberle, co-director of Rebekah Templeton Gallery.
